lsp软件库合集软件资料链接: 全面提升开发效率的资源汇总

分类:攻略 日期:

LSP(Language Server Protocol)软件库的汇总能够显著提升开发工作效率。LSP是一种用于在代码编辑器与各种编程语言之间进行通用通信的协议,它为IDE和文本编辑器提供了语言特定的功能,如代码自动补全、错误检查和代码导航等。因此,整合LSP软件库使得开发者能够在统一的环境中享受多种编程语言的支持,进而提升开发效率。

为了实现这一目标,开发者可以利用一些开源和商业的LSP软件库。这些库通常包含多种语言的实现,例如JavaScript、Python、Go等,适配不同的开发环境和编辑器。通过使用这些库,开发者无需为每种语言单独配置和维护工具链。比如,使用像TypeScript的语言服务器,开发者将能够在编写代码时获得即时反馈,帮助更快地发现和修复问题。

lsp软件库合集软件资料链接: 全面提升开发效率的资源汇总

此外,社区在LSP软件库的开发和维护中也起到重要作用。许多开发者和组织积极参与开源项目,使得新特性和功能能够迅速融入到实际开发中。通过查阅各大代码托管平台及相关社区论坛,开发者可以找到最新的LSP软件库和相关资源,包括初始化配置示例、最佳实践和常见问题解答。

开发者在整合LSP软件库时,可以利用现成的插件和工具,如Visual Studio Code、Atom等流行的代码编辑器,它们通常提供了对LSP的原生支持。这种整合不仅能提高个人开发效率,还有助于促进团队协作,使团队成员能够在统一的开发环境中进行高效的沟通和代码共享。

通过合理使用LSP软件库,开发者不仅节省了时间和精力,还能够提升代码质量和项目的可维护性。随着编程语言和框架的不断进化,定期更新和探索新兴LSP库将成为开发者保持竞争力的重要手段。正因如此,LSP软件库的整合与运用将成为现代软件开发不可或缺的一部分。